Umgungundlovu TVET College offers a variety of courses, both full-time and part-time programmes. There are five campuses. Assistance is provided to students when applying for finacial aid. NSFAS provides financial relief to low income households. All students are encouraged to apply for NSFAS.

Campuses:

  • Edendale Campus
  • Midlands Campus
  • Msunduzi Campus
  • Northdale Campus
  • Plessislaer Campus
